Lab 2 — Your First API Call¶
⏱️ ~20 min
Call an LLM from code and watch temperature change the output. Open in Colab, or run locally with Python 3.11+.

# Setup
import os, getpass
PROVIDER = "openai" # or "anthropic"
if PROVIDER == "openai":
!pip install -q openai
if not os.environ.get("OPENAI_API_KEY"):
os.environ["OPENAI_API_KEY"] = getpass.getpass("OpenAI API key: ")
else:
!pip install -q anthropic
if not os.environ.get("ANTHROPIC_API_KEY"):
os.environ["ANTHROPIC_API_KEY"] = getpass.getpass("Anthropic API key: ")
print(f"Provider set to: {PROVIDER}")

def chat(messages, temperature=0.7, model=None):
if PROVIDER == "openai":
from openai import OpenAI
client = OpenAI()
resp = client.chat.completions.create(
model=model or "gpt-4o-mini", messages=messages, temperature=temperature)
return resp.choices[0].message.content
else:
from anthropic import Anthropic
client = Anthropic()
system = "".join(m["content"] for m in messages if m["role"] == "system")
turns = [m for m in messages if m["role"] != "system"]
resp = client.messages.create(
model=model or "claude-3-5-haiku-20241022", max_tokens=1024,
temperature=temperature, system=system or None, messages=turns)
return resp.content[0].text

Temperature: 0 is repeatable, high is creative¶
Run each a few times and compare the variation.
In [ ]:
Copied!
prompt = [{"role": "user", "content": "Invent a name for a coffee shop for programmers."}]
print("temp=0.0 :", chat(prompt, temperature=0.0))
print("temp=0.0 :", chat(prompt, temperature=0.0))
print("temp=1.0 :", chat(prompt, temperature=1.0))
print("temp=1.0 :", chat(prompt, temperature=1.0))

Try it: change PROVIDER, swap the model, push temperature to 1.5.
Notice temp=0 barely changes between runs; temp=1 varies a lot.
